VILLALBA, María Sofía. Non-Conventional Hydrocarbons in Argentina: Explorations in the Profound, Transformations in the Territories. Territ. [online]. 2018, n.39, pp.225-243. ISSN 0123-8418.

The development of non-conventional hydrocarbons in the United States has generated a revolution in the oil industry worldwide. Then, other countries begin to explore their resources. The Neuquen and the Golfo San Jorge basins, and more recently the Austral Magallanes basin in Argentina have seen since the decade of 2010 the disembarkation of the activity in their territories. The latter are transformed economically, socially and environmentally due to the new dynamics that are installed. This paper seeks to analyze the main transformations in Argentine cities close to the non-conventional hydrocarbons activity. For this, we worked with primary sources, based on interviews with qualified informants and secondary sources, mainly bibliographic and press material. It is observed that the Neuquina basin, pioneer in the development of the activity, goes through the major transformations in its territory, mainly in the city of Añelo. In contrast, the incipient explorations in the territories of the Golfo San Jorge and the Austral Magallanes basins still do not generate important changes.

Palabras clave : Non-Conventional hydrocarbons; explorations; territories; transformations; Argentina.
